Default lsvtec + automatic? possible?

As the title states. i have a 95 integra automatic, and was wondering if its possible to make my ls block into a lsvtec? and run it off the auto tranny?

if i can what kind of possible bad things can happen

if i can what type of modifications need to be made?

I have no experience with such a thing, so here's just my best guesses. Not sure why you'd want to do such a build though...

There was a GSR automatic in Japan, so you'd probably need the ECU from one. Other than that, it shouldn't be much different than a normal lsvtec build. However, if the ECU tries to rev the car too much into the high end, and you don't build the bottom end to handle the increased revs, you'll have a short engine life.
